The Cecilian Singers was founded in 1962 and it is one of Hong Kong’s oldest running mixed choirs. We sing a wide-ranging repertoire from madrigals to world music; by composers ancient and modern, both a capella and accompanied. Our programmes reflect our love of choral diversity and it is something we are known for. The choir’s original aim was to promote European choral music with a repertoire spanning at least five centuries. It started out predominantly as an a cappella group, performing both sacred and secular music. Over the years, the choir has also sung some larger works by composers such as Bach, Beethoven, Mozart and Handel, often with a small orchestra and soloists.
